## Runbook: Digest Scheduler Stall

Symptom: users report missing daily digests from Mailloom. Check the scheduler dashboard first. If the queue depth is flat, the cron worker likely lost its lease — restart `digest-cron` via the ops console. Confirm recovery by watching the sent-count metric for ten minutes. If rows are stuck in `pending`, inspect the jobs table directly by connecting with the string below.

replica DSN, tawef-hahap: mysql://eliix_svc:FiIC0jz@db-394a.lumiclabs.internal:5432/holius

## Step 6: Mitigate the planner regression

Quernstone 9.4 introduced a query planner regression that drops row-level filters under certain join reorderings. Security impact: tenant isolation predicates can be bypassed. Upgrade to 9.4.2 or pin the planner to legacy mode. Audit query logs for affected plans before and after. Apply the mitigating settings shown below.

config for kagup-hahig:
druwyn:
  pin: 2801
  metrics_host: metrics.druwyn.zemvarlabs.internal
  tenant: sorius
  seal: seal_798a43d7

## Formula sandbox tuning

User-supplied formulas in Gridmoor execute inside a restricted interpreter with hard ceilings on time, memory, and call depth. Reviewers should confirm any change to these ceilings is justified in the PR description, since raising them widens the abuse surface. Defaults were chosen from production traces. The current limits are as follows.

limits module of tafog-fawip:
WEIGHTS = {
    "julix": 57,
    "lamys": 992,
    "kasvan": 209,
    "quenok": 750,
    "alddor": 259,
    "oliath": 1009,
    "wenix": 815,
}

### Step 4: Stabilize the integration suite

Before merging the Pebblepay migration, sort out the flaky tests first — most failures trace back to the sandbox ledger timing out under parallel runs. We've serialized the settlement specs and bumped the retry budget, so reviewers should see green runs consistently now. The test-environment configuration the suite now expects is given below.

deployment values, fahap-hahaf:
[casdor]
port = 9200
region = south-2
host = casdor.qirvanworks.corp
timeout_ms = 3000
retries = 4